Material Design was developed by Google in 2014 as a design language. Its core idea is to create a visual language that synthesizes classic principles of good design with the innovation and possibility of technology and science. Material Design focuses on a more tangible user interface, where elements are treated like physical objects with surfaces, edges, and shadows, ensuring a clean and consistent experience across different platforms and devices.
The primary goal of Material Design is to create a unified and intuitive interface that adapts seamlessly across all screen sizes, from smartphones to large desktop monitors. The use of bold colors, typography, and deliberate spacing helps users interact more naturally with digital products.
Key Principles of Material Design
Material as a Metaphor: Material Design takes inspiration from physical materials like paper and ink. It emphasizes surfaces and edges, giving users a sense of hierarchy and organization through layering and shadows. Elements in Material Design behave in a predictable way, enhancing the user experience by providing visual clarity.
Bold, Intentional Design: Material Design uses bold, vibrant colors, intentional white spaces, and large typography. This clarity helps users focus on their tasks, improves readability, and creates a visually pleasing interface. The boldness of the design also encourages consistency across devices.
Meaningful Motion: Motion is key in Material Design. It is used to provide feedback, guide the user, and add meaning to transitions. Animations are smooth and deliberate, reinforcing the relationship between user actions and on-screen changes.
Adaptive Design: Material Design is highly adaptable to different screen sizes and devices. This ensures that no matter the platform, users enjoy a consistent experience. It allows developers and designers to create cohesive interfaces without worrying about losing the visual quality on different devices.
Why Should You Use Material Design?
Consistency Across Platforms: Material Design offers a design system that ensures consistency across different devices, operating systems, and screen sizes. This uniformity helps businesses and developers maintain a cohesive brand presence. Users benefit from this familiarity, allowing them to navigate apps and websites more easily.
User-Centered Design: Material Design’s focus on simplicity and clarity enhances usability. With a clean, structured layout, users can quickly find information and complete tasks. This makes it easier to create apps and websites that users find intuitive and enjoyable.
Easy Customization and Scalability: While Material Design comes with its own guidelines, it’s flexible enough for designers to tweak and customize. The framework allows for easy adaptation to your brand’s needs, ensuring that you can maintain your identity while still following proven design principles. Explore admin dashboards built on Material Design to experience its perfect blend of aesthetics and functionality.
Strong Community and Resources: Since Material Design is a widely adopted framework, there are numerous resources, libraries, and tools available to help developers and designers. The active community means that new features and improvements are frequently added, keeping the design language modern and up-to-date.
Built-in Accessibility: Accessibility is an essential consideration in any design framework, and Material Design prioritizes it. Its design principles ensure that apps and websites are usable by as many people as possible, including those with disabilities. Elements like contrast, touch targets, and font size are designed to ensure easy interaction for all users.
Backed by Google: Material Design is created and maintained by Google, which means it comes with a robust set of guidelines and frequent updates. Google’s commitment to making the web more user-friendly gives designers and developers a high level of trust in the framework.
Conclusion
Material Design provides a powerful, adaptable design language that can help you create consistent, user-friendly digital products. Its principles of clarity, boldness, and simplicity can significantly enhance the user experience across different devices. By using Material Design, businesses, and developers can ensure a cohesive, accessible, and visually pleasing interface that users will enjoy.
Comments